truthsayer Posted November 25, 2013 Report Posted November 25, 2013 Turn off all loudness features, and sub level to the max postion to get the most voltage from HU. Make sure you have set crossover freq correct. No way you should hace amp gain all the way up. If your head unit is 4v pre out, your looking at the gain being around 1/4 turned up or the 9;30 position. If HU is 2v preout, amps gain around the 12o'clock position. If your still not getting desired bass from subs, on the HU you may have to adjust the bass setting. truthsayer
